From definition

A decinewton meter is one tenth of a newton meter, a metric submultiple of the newton meter.

To definition

The kilogram-force meter (kgf m) is torque produced by one kilogram-force applied at a one meter perpendicular distance.

Formula

kgf m = dN m × 0.0101971621298

Formula

kgf m = dN m × 0.0101971621298

dN m = kgf m ÷ 0.0101971621298

Conversion table

1 dN m0.010197 kgf m
5 dN m0.050986 kgf m
10 dN m0.101972 kgf m
20 dN m0.203943 kgf m
50 dN m0.509858 kgf m
100 dN m1.019716 kgf m
500 dN m5.098581 kgf m
1000 dN m10.197162 kgf m

Frequently asked questions

What is the source unit in this conversion?

The source unit is the decinewton meter (dN m). A decinewton meter is one tenth of a newton meter, a metric submultiple of the newton meter.

What is the destination unit in this conversion?

The destination unit is the kilogram-force meter (kgf m). The kilogram-force meter (kgf m) is torque produced by one kilogram-force applied at a one meter perpendicular distance.

How do I convert decinewton meters to kilogram force meters?

Multiply the number of decinewton meters by 0.0101971621298 to get the equivalent value in kilogram force meters. For example, 5 dN m × 0.0101971621298 = 0.050986 kgf m.

Is the decinewton meter to kilogram-force meter conversion exact?

Yes. This converter uses a fixed factor of 0.0101971621298, so results are precise and consistent every time you use it.

Where is this conversion commonly used?

It's used in mechanical and automotive engineering, structural torque analysis, product specifications, and any context where you need to switch between decinewton meter and kilogram-force meter values.

Can I convert kilogram force meters back to decinewton meters?

Yes. Multiply the kilogram force meters value by 98.0665, or divide it by 0.0101971621298, to convert back to decinewton meters.
